Who is Eligible? It's Easy...

Membership is open to anyone who lives, works, worships, or attends school in our service area.

Service Area

Membership is open to anyone who lives, works, worships, or attends school in:

  • Montrose County
  • Delta County
  • Gunnison County
  • Ouray County
  • San Miguel County

What's Required to Join?

When you join NuVista, you become part owner in the Credit Union. You must open and maintain a Share (Savings) Account with a minimum deposit of $25.00. This $25 represents your ownership share in the credit union.

Credit unions are member-owned, not-for-profit financial cooperatives. This means profits are returned to members through better rates, lower fees, and improved services. As a member-owner, you have a voice in how the credit union operates.

Yes! Your deposits are federally insured by the National Credit Union Administration (NCUA) up to $250,000, providing the same protection as FDIC insurance for banks.
